""" This module manages the configuration for redhat-support-tool.
Configuration options are stored in $HOME/.rhhelp and this module
will both create this configuration file and handle the prompting
of the user for the data which will be stored therein.

To get a configuration you should begin by calling:
 - confighelper.get_config_helper()

This will return an instance of ConfigHelper which has getter
methods for the important configuration options.

"""

    def __xor(self, salt, string):
        '''
        A simple utility function to obfuscate the password when a user
        elects to save it in the config file.  We're not necessarily
        going for strong encryption here (eg. a keystore) because that
        would require a user supplied PW to unlock the keystore.

        We're merely trying to provide a convenience against an
        accidental display of the file (eg. cat ~/.rhhelp).
        '''
        str_ary = []
        for x, y in izip(string, cycle(salt)):
            str_ary.append(chr(ord(x) ^ ord(y)))
        return ''.join(str_ary)

    def pw_decode(self, password, key):
        '''
        This convenience function will de-obfuscate a password or other value
        previously obfuscated with pw_encode()

        Returns the de-obfuscated string
        '''
        if password and key:
            password = base64.standard_b64decode(password)
            return self.__xor(key, password)
        else:
            return None

    def pw_encode(self, password, key):
        '''
        This convenience function will obfuscated a password or other value

        Returns the obfuscated string
        '''
        if password and key:
            passwd = self.__xor(key, password)
            return base64.urlsafe_b64encode(passwd)
        else:
            return None
